Additional Features for Eterm for Windows
In addition to the configuration menu, Eterm contains menu options for the following additional
features.
Connect
Click Connect to open a connection with the host system using the current configuration
settings.
Dial
Click Dial to open the Dial dialog box, where you can select a telephone number from either the
global or the local dialing directory.
Disconnect
Click Disconnect to close a connection with the host system using the current configuration
settings. Always remember to first log off Eclipse before disconnecting from Eterm.
Edit
Use the Eterm editing tools to select and copy text or screen elements to the Windows clipboard
or to paste the contents of the Windows clipboard into Eclipse word processing or view function
screens.
• Select – Click Select to begin selecting text or line drawing characters with the mouse
from Eclipse screens. First select the text or screen elements, and then click Copy.
• Extended select – Click Extended select to begin selecting text with the mouse from an
Eclipse word processing or view function screen. You can select entire screens, including
line drawing characters, but not dialog boxes. First select the text or screen elements, and
then click Copy.
• Copy – Click Copy to copy the currently selected text or screen elements to the
Windows clipboard.
• Paste – Click Paste to paste the contents of the Windows clipboard into an Eclipse word
processing field.
Print
Select Print to send a copy of the currently displayed screen to the printer, a file, or a debug file.
